What truly drives long-term growth in a financial advisory business? Is it better tools, stronger strategies, or something far more human at the core? In this first episode of season 4 of the Focused on the Future podcast, host Suzanne Siracuse interviews Dany Martin, partner and wealth advisor at WFA, about how relationship-first thinking shapes a sustainable advisory business. He shares how early exposure to residual income led him into financial planning, and how serving athletes and women became a natural extension of his values. Dany also explains how artificial intelligence is enhancing efficiency without replacing human connection, and why hiring career changers has strengthened his firm’s culture and client experience.
